Output 57402503e033dc28cd3912b08ccfc81f6e7611dfec1f52c9f99dcce646c4d9b0:1

value
68856575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b07c840c20a7b8495b078fec12f84ee0cb6362 OP_EQUAL
address
33DGA6tgHuUvzvwTSKhTb4XbWa3aZxv1HR
transaction
57402503e033dc28cd3912b08ccfc81f6e7611dfec1f52c9f99dcce646c4d9b0
spent
true